Market Ecosystem: Key Product Categories, Stakeholders, and Demand-Supply Framework **Product Categories:** – **Standard EGA:** Purity levels of 99.5%–99.9%, suitable for general applications. – **High-Purity EGA:** Purity levels exceeding 99.99%, essential for semiconductor and display manufacturing. – **Specialty EGA:** Customized formulations with additives or specific impurity profiles tailored for niche applications. **Stakeholders:** – **Raw Material Suppliers:** Petrochemical producers providing benzene, propylene, and other precursors. – **Chemical Manufacturers:** South Korean and global players producing EGA, investing in purification and quality control. – **Equipment & Technology Providers:** Suppliers of distillation, filtration, and analytical instruments ensuring product quality. – **End-Users:** Semiconductor fabs, display manufacturers, research institutions, and specialty chemical firms. – **Distributors & Logistics:** Regional and global logistics firms managing storage, transportation, and inventory. **Demand-Supply Framework:** The market operates on a just-in-time supply model, with key players maintaining strategic inventories to mitigate raw material volatility. Domestic manufacturing is dominant, with imports supplementing supply during capacity expansions or disruptions. The demand is highly concentrated among a few large semiconductor and display firms, with a growing segment of smaller OEMs adopting high-purity acetone for specialized processes. Value Chain and Revenue Models **Raw Material Sourcing:** Petrochemical feedstocks such as benzene and propylene are sourced primarily from South Korea’s integrated refineries and petrochemical complexes, with some imports from the Middle East and China. Vertical integration in the supply chain minimizes costs and ensures quality consistency. **Manufacturing:** South Korean chemical producers employ advanced distillation, adsorption, and membrane purification technologies to produce EGA at varying purity levels. Capital investments focus on high-capacity distillation columns, real-time analytical systems, and automation to enhance throughput and quality. **Distribution & Logistics:** Distribution channels include direct sales to large end-users, regional chemical distributors, and online procurement platforms. Cold chain logistics and specialized containers are used to preserve solvent integrity during transportation. **End-User Delivery & Lifecycle Services:** Manufacturers provide technical support, quality assurance, and on-site testing. Lifecycle services include maintenance of purity standards, process optimization consulting, and environmental compliance management. **Revenue Models:** – **Product Sales:** Based on volume, purity grade, and customization. – **Value-Added Services:** Technical consulting, quality assurance, and process integration support. – **Long-term Contracts:** Supply agreements with key customers providing stable revenue streams. Cost Structures, Pricing Strategies, and Investment Patterns **Cost Structures:** – Raw materials constitute approximately 40–50% of production costs, with energy and labor accounting for the remainder. – Capital expenditure on purification infrastructure and automation ranges from USD 10–50 million per facility, depending on capacity. **Pricing Strategies:** – Premium pricing for high-purity grades aligned with semiconductor standards. – Volume discounts for large OEM contracts. – Dynamic pricing models reflecting raw material price fluctuations and supply-demand dynamics. **Investment Patterns:** – Focused on capacity expansion, upgrading purification technology, and digital infrastructure. – Increasing R&D investments in sustainable and bio-based acetone alternatives. **Operating Margins:** Typically range from 15–25%, with higher margins achievable in high-purity segments due to premium pricing and technological barriers to entry. Adoption Trends & End-User Insights **Semiconductor Sector:** High adoption of ultra-pure EGA for wafer cleaning, lithography, and etching processes. Real-world use cases include Samsung’s advanced chip fabrication lines, which demand EGA purity levels exceeding 99.9999%. **Display Manufacturing:** Growing OLED and LCD production lines require high-grade acetone for cleaning and patterning, with shifting consumption patterns favoring smaller, more specialized batches. **Emerging Niches:** – Use in pharmaceutical manufacturing for solvent-based extraction processes. – Application in environmental remediation technologies. **Consumption Patterns:** – Increasing preference for environmentally friendly, low-emission solvents. – Adoption of digital monitoring tools to optimize usage and reduce waste.
